Ingredients
- 1 lb beef (cut into thin strips)
- 1 onion (chopped)
- 8 oz mushrooms (sliced)
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- 2 tbsp butter (divided)
- 1 cup beef broth
- 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ard
- 4 oz cream cheese (softened)
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- Salt (to taste)
- Pepper (to taste)
- Parsley (for garnish, optional)
Directions
- Slice the beef into thin strips, about 1/4-inch thick. Chop the onion and slice the mushrooms, then mince the garlic. Set everything aside for smooth cooking.
- In a large skillet, melt 1 tablespoon of butter over medium-high heat. Once sizzling, add the beef in a single layer, seasoning with salt and pepper. Sear until browned, about 1-2 minutes per side, then transfer to a plate.
- Add the remaining tablespoon of butter to the same skillet. Toss in the chopped onion and sliced mushrooms, cooking until the onions are soft and mushrooms are golden brown, about 4-5 minutes.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for another 30 seconds until fragrant.
- Pour in 1 cup of beef broth, scraping the browned bits from the bottom of the skillet. Lower the heat to medium, then stir in the Worcestershire sauce and Dijon mustard, letting it simmer gently for 2 minutes.
- Whisk in 4 oz of cream cheese until it’s melted and smooth. Then, fold in 1/2 cup of sour cream, stirring until creamy and well combined. Make sure to keep the heat low; do not let it boil!
- Return the seared beef and any juices from the plate back into the skillet. Toss everything to coat in that rich sauce, heating through for an additional 1-2 minutes.
- Dish out the stroganoff over cauliflower mash, zucchini noodles, or your favorite keto-friendly alternative. Sprinkle with fresh parsley for a lovely touch!

how to store Creamy Keto Beef Stroganoff
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. When reheating, make sure to do it gently on low heat to maintain the creamy texture. Add a splash of beef broth if needed to thin out the sauce.
tips to make Creamy Keto Beef Stroganoff
- Slice beef thinly: For the best texture, ensure the beef is sliced thinly against the grain. This will keep it tender.
- Keep the heat low: When adding cream cheese and sour cream, keep the heat low to avoid curdling.
- Adjust seasonings to taste: Feel free to tweak the salt, pepper, or add herbs like thyme for extra flavor.

FAQs
Can I use another type of meat for this recipe?
Yes, you can substitute beef with chicken or turkey. Just adjust the cooking time accordingly, as poultry will cook faster.
Is this dish suitable for meal prep?
Absolutely! Creamy Keto Beef Stroganoff can be made in advance and stored in the fridge or freezer. Just be sure to reheat it gently to maintain the creamy consistency.
